ABOUT HELIENE

Heliene is a fast-paced entrepreneurial company growing rapidly in a highly desirable industry, with a mission to be part of the solution to climate challenges and contribute to a better planet.

Heliene has taken the challenge to help the world reduce its reliance on fossil fuels, by striving to be a leader in renewable energy. We are a manufacturer of high efficiency and high-quality solar modules. Our modules are produced on state-of-the-art solar manufacturing lines in Ontario-Canada, Minnesota-USA, and at manufacturing partners around the world.

Heliene is seeking a Director of Product Reliability Engineering to lead our Reliability Engineering Program. Reporting to the Chief Technology Officer, the Director of Product Reliability Engineering will have overall responsibility of research, assessment, selection of materials, and preparation and implementation of company-wide product reliability plans. This is a unique opportunity for a highly skilled, experienced, and motivated individual to join a team that is developing solutions to tackle the climate crisis with strong development and manufacturing presence in North America.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Develop reliability engineering programs for standard products and custom products and implement them.
  • Lead Company’s programs to achieve extended reliability status and reliability scorecard targets.
  • Perform failure analysis and root cause studies at system, module, and material level. Identify and validate failure modes. Identify and validate corrective actions and implement them.
  • Develop failure analysis capabilities. Develop metrology capabilities.
  • Design, develop, test, launch and sustain PV Products (modules and electronics) for long-term reliability. Identify materials and materials combinations that contribute to long-term reliability of PV Products.
  • Develop plans for and subject materials, coupons, and modules to a broad set environmental and weathering conditions. Analyze and present results and devise the next course of action.
  • Work closely with design, product, process, test, and operations teams to ensure system and component reliability goals are met.
  • Design and develop new reliability test techniques, methods and procedures. Follow industry standard reliability protocols. Develop custom reliability plans where necessary.
  • Research structures and properties of materials and material interactions to ensure reliable operation of the solar modules for the warranty duration.
  • Develop or qualify new materials, as necessary.

Minimum Qualifications:

M.S. in Mechanical Engineering, Chemical Engineering, Materials Science, Physics, or related field with eight (8) years of direct experience in PV Reliability Engineering and four (4) years of supervisory experience or an equivalent combination of education, experience, and training.

  • PhD in a related field is considered an asset.
  • Direct experience working in a manufacturing environment is considered an asset.
  • Deep understanding of materials and processes that contribute to long-term reliability of PV modules.
  • Demonstrated ability to design, develop, test, launch, and sustain PV products for reliability.
  • Hands-on experience with solar panel manufacturing, accelerated testing, and failure analysis.
  • Hands-on experience setting up and operating PV reliability test equipment, PV failure analysis, and PV metrology equipment such as climate chambers, microscopy, spectroscopy, x-ray, ellipsometry, calorimetry, x-ray, XRD, SEM, DSC, TGA.
  • Experience testing solar components at material, module, and system levels for reliability and performance.
  • Experience of certification, compliance, and extended reliability testing of solar panels.
  • Highly skilled in one or more programming languages, lab tools, data analytics, and analysis.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
